Larry Fortensky Critically Injured in Fall

Larry Fortensky, an ex-husband of actress Elizabeth Taylor, was in critical condition Thursday after apparently falling down a flight of stairs in his San Juan Capistrano home, authorities said.

Fortensky, 46, was taken to Mission Hospital Regional Medical Center in Mission Viejo after 3 a.m. with head and chest injuries, a hospital spokeswoman said.

Orange County Sheriff’s Lt. Hector Rivera said a woman called 911 at 3:06 a.m. to report that a friend had fallen down stairs. Paramedics arrived at the home on Avenida Evita within minutes.

“There was nothing to indicate anything suspicious other than a medical aid call,” Rivera said.

Taylor’s publicist, Shirine Ann Coburn, said Taylor had been notified. The Oscar-winning actress was “deeply shocked and her prayers are with Larry Fortensky,” Coburn said.

Taylor and Fortensky met in 1988 when both were patients at the Betty Ford Center in Rancho Mirage. They married in October 1991 at Michael Jackson’s Neverland Ranch in Santa Barbara County. Taylor filed for divorce in February 1996, citing irreconcilable differences.
